It’s a very nice waterfront along the River Mersey that leads to the sea. The White Star (Titanic) was founded in Liverpool. The Titanic was funded in Liverpool, built in Belfast, and sailed out of Southampton.
These two birds on top of the The Royal Liver Building face opposite directions. One looks out over the sea watching over the people who leave. The other looks out over the city watching the families that remained behind. If the birds ever turned to look at each other, they would fly off and leave the city in ruin; as the protection is gone.
